What car was Eleanor in Gone in 60 seconds? In the movie Gone in 60 Seconds, Eleanor is a rare and highly valuable 1967 Shelby Mustang GT500 that Memphis and his team are tasked with stealing. The Mustang is considered the "holy grail" of the group's car theft ring and the final car they need to steal to complete their mission.

As HotCars contributor Arun Singh Pundir points out, "Eleanor" was actually meant to " be a 1973 Mach I model in the 1974-movie Gone in 60 Seconds, but in truth was a decked-up 1971 model." Halicki bought the car in 1971 and revamped it to look like a 1973 Mustang.

In the 2000 remake of Gone in 60 Seconds, Eleanor was the name used to refer to rare Shelby GT500s, one of which was gray and black. It is this GT500 that has become synonymous with the Eleanor name.
